通訊端選項
本節說明各種 Windows 作業系統版本的 Winsock 通訊端選項。 使用 getsockopt 和 setsockopt 函式取得和設定通訊端選項。 若要列舉通訊協定,並探索每個已安裝通訊協定的支援屬性,請使用 WSAEnumProtocols 函 式。
某些通訊端選項需要比這些資料表所能傳達更多的說明;這類選項包含其他頁面的連結。
-
IPPROTO_IP
-
-
IPv4 層級適用的通訊端選項。 如需詳細資訊,請參閱 IPPROTO_IP 通訊端選項。
-
-
IPPROTO_IPV6
-
-
IPv6 層級適用的通訊端選項。 如需詳細資訊,請參閱 IPPROTO_IPV6 通訊端選項。
-
-
IPPROTO_RM
-
-
適用于可靠多播層級的通訊端選項。 如需詳細資訊,請參閱 IPPROTO_RM 通訊端選項。
-
-
IPPROTO_TCP
-
-
通訊端選項適用于 TCP 層級。 如需詳細資訊,請參閱 IPPROTO_TCP 通訊端選項。
-
-
IPPROTO_UDP
-
-
UDP 層級適用的通訊端選項。 如需詳細資訊,請參閱 IPPROTO_UDP 通訊端選項。
-
-
NSPROTO_IPX
-
-
IPX 層級適用的通訊端選項。 如需詳細資訊,請參閱 NSPROTO_IPX 通訊端選項。
-
-
SOL_APPLETALK
-
-
AppleTalk 層級適用的通訊端選項。 如需詳細資訊,請參閱 SOL_APPLETALK 通訊端選項。
-
-
SOL_IRLMP
-
-
適用于 InfraRed Link 管理通訊協定層級的通訊端選項。 如需詳細資訊,請參閱 SOL_IRLMP 通訊端選項。
-
-
SOL_SOCKET
-
-
通訊端選項適用于通訊端層級。 如需詳細資訊,請參閱 SOL_SOCKET 通訊端選項。
-
備註
除了 SO_BROADCAST 以外,所有 SO_* 通訊端選項都同樣適用于 IPv4 和 IPv6 (,因為不會在 IPv6) 中實作廣播。